About Phoebe ‘Wander Woman’ Smith
Phoebe Smith is an adventurer, travel writer, and photographer who specializes in extreme sleeping and wild camping experiences. From sleeping in caves and disused buildings to camping on mountain tops and underneath giant boulders, Phoebe seeks out strange and extreme places to spend the night. Her love for wilderness has taken her on solo expeditions all around the world, including at Everest Base Camp and the North Pole.
As an award-winning travel writer, presenter, and broadcaster, Phoebe shares her experiences through various platforms, such as The Guardian, The Telegraph, and BBC Radio 4. She is also the host of the Wander Woman Podcast, an audio travel magazine. Phoebe is the author of several books, including the best-selling "Extreme Sleeps: Adventures of a Wild Camper.
" Beyond her personal adventures, Phoebe is passionate about inspiring young people and supporting homeless charities. She has raised over £42,000 for Centrepoint through her Extreme Sleep Outs and co-founded the #WeTwo Foundation to take underprivileged youth to Antarctica. Endorsed by renowned travel writer Bill Bryson and recognized for her contributions to the outdoor community, Phoebe is an ambassador for various outdoor initiatives, including the Ordnance Survey #GetOutside Champion program.
